Transaction

bd3b6522eddac7dc7feb5a88bd4efec7e42d2eb87e088ad726203aa431faec54
514,713 confirmations
Timestamp
1470535392
Block424,060
Fee13,620 sats
Fee rate60.3 sats/vB
view on mempool.space

Inputs & Outputs